Tom Brady is entering his 20th season in the NFL, and his jersey has said the same team for all 20 years: Patriots

Yet, that hasn't stopped fans from needing to buy more Brady jerseys any time soon.


According to NFLPA, Brady has landed atop the first Top 50 Player Sales List of the year, which includes sales for all officially licensed NFL player products and merchandise from March 1 to May 31. This comes just three months after he topped off the year-end NFLPA Top 50 Sales List last season.

Also in the top five are Odell Beckham at No. 2, Khalil Mack at No. 3, Sam Darnold at No. 4, and Baker Mayfield at No. 5. Rounding out the top 10 are Patrick Mahomes, Aaron Rodgers, Antonio Brown, Ezekiel Elliott, and Saquon Barkley, respectively.

The veteran quarterback isn't the only Patriot on the list. He is joined in the top 20 by Julian Edelman at No. 15 and Rob Gronkowski at No. 17. The Patriots also closed out the list with Stephon Gilmore at No. 50.

Brady is entering the final year of his contract, which Bill Belichick addressed Wednesday morning. He and the rest of the team began training camp Thursday, though they are without Edelman, who reportedly broke his thumb.
